Approval and Promulgation of Air Quality Implementation Plans; Pennsylvania; VOC and NO X RACT Determinations for Four Individual Sources Located in the Pittsburgh-Beaver Valley Area; Withdrawal of Direct Final Rule
AGENCY:
Environmental Protection Agency (EPA).
ACTION:
Withdrawal of direct final rule.
SUMMARY:
Due to receipt of a letter of adverse comment, EPA is withdrawing the direct final rule to approve revisions which establish reasonably available control technology (RACT) requirements for four major sources of volatile organic compounds (VOC) and nitrogen oxides (NO X ) located in the Pittsburgh-Beaver Valley ozone nonattainment area. In the direct final rule published on August 10, 2001 (66 FR 42136), EPA stated that if it received adverse comment by September 10, 2001, the rule would be withdrawn and not take effect. EPA subsequently received adverse comments from the Citizens for Pennsylvania's Future (PennFuture). EPA will address the comments received in a subsequent final action based upon the proposed action also published on August 10, 2001 (66 FR 42187). EPA will not institute a second comment period on this action.
EFFECTIVE DATE:
The direct final rule is withdrawn as of September 20, 2001.
